On 06/11/2012 11:36 PM, Thomas Pedersen wrote:
> This patch fixes a bug where no capabilites are parsed when the number
> of firmware capability bits translate into fewer bytes than the host has
> knowledge of. Instead just process number of capability bytes as
> reported by the firmware.
